Purpose:

This laboratory provides practice in the creation and use of basic and advanced SQL queries involving one table in a DB schema.

Procedure:

Using your assigned user name, password, and host string, log in to Oracle SQL*Plus, and open a spool file to collect your dialog.  Create queries to answer the following questions.  Your queries should be written so that they use only the data provided and display only the data requested.

Don't edit the initial spool file. You will make mistakes and will not be penalized for them.  Attach it to the back of your report.  Follow the instructor's instruction concerning any additional required items, any needed sign-offs, and the due date of this report.

Part A:

1. Display the ids and names for all customers.

2. Display all the data in the sales representative table.

3. Display the names of all customers whose credit limits are $10,000 or more.

4. Display the invoice number for all orders placed by the customer whose id is 1619 on September 13, 2007.  Please note: A date in a condition should be in the form '13-SEP-07'.

5. Display the id and the name for all customers whose sales representative has an id of either 237 or 268.

6. Display the id and description for all products whose type is not AP.

7. Display the id, the description, and the number of items for each product that has between 12 and 30 items. Perform this query two different ways.

8. Display the id, the description, and the total value (product quantity * product price) of each product whose product type is HW.  Assign the column name TOTAL_VALUE to this calculation.

9. Display the id, the description, and the total value (product quantity * product price) of each product whose total value is greater than or equal to $4,000.  Assign the column name TOTAL_VALUE to the calculation.

10. Display the id and the description for each product whose type is either SG or AP using the IN operator.

11. Determine the id and the name of each customer whose name starts with the letter "S".

Part B:

12. Display all the data in the products table.  Order the display by the product description.

13. Display all the data in the products table.  Order the display by product type.  Within each product type, order the display by product id.

14. Determine the number of customers whose balances are less than their credit limits.

15. Display the total of the balances of all customers who are represented by sales representative 237 and whose balances are less than their credit limits.

16. Display the id, the description, and the total value of each product whose number of items is greater than the average number of items for all products. You may want to use a subquery.

17. Display the balance of the customer whose balance is the smallest.

18. Display the id, the name, and the balance of the customer with the largest balance.

19. Display the sales representative's id and the sum of the balances of all customers represented by each of these sales representatives. Group and order the display by the sales representative ids.

20. Display the sales representative's id and the sum of the balances of all customers represented by each of these sales representatives, but limit the result to those sales representatives whose sum is more than $12,000.

21. Display the ids of all products whose description is not known.
